Can siblings go back?

0

Siblings are welcome to watch during the exam and cleaning procedures. Children receiving restorative treatment are often distracted by siblings in the treatment room; it is recommended that a single parent attend during restorative treatment procedures with the patient while other family members remain in the reception room. Children under six will need a supervisory adult with them.
